GLP-1s and Kidney Health: A Protective Partnership

GLP-1 receptor agonists (GLP-1 RAs) have revolutionized the management of type 2 diabetes and obesity. Beyond their well-known effects on blood sugar and weight, a growing body of evidence, now firmly established by 2026, highlights their profound protective benefits for kidney health. This protective partnership represents a significant advancement in preventing and managing chronic kidney disease (CKD), particularly for individuals living with diabetes.

The mechanisms behind GLP-1 RAs' kidney-protective effects are multifaceted and increasingly understood. Firstly, their primary role in improving glycemic control directly reduces the burden of high blood sugar on the kidneys—a major driver of diabetic kidney disease. Secondly, many GLP-1 RAs contribute to modest but clinically significant reductions in blood pressure. Hypertension is another critical factor in kidney damage and progression, so this benefit further supports renal health.

However, the benefits extend significantly beyond these indirect effects. Robust research indicates that GLP-1 RAs exert direct protective actions on the kidneys themselves. These include anti-inflammatory and anti-fibrotic properties, which help to mitigate damage to delicate kidney structures. They have also been consistently shown to reduce albuminuria, a key marker of kidney damage and a predictor of CKD progression, signifying improved renal function and integrity. Furthermore, some studies suggest improvements in renal hemodynamics, optimizing blood flow within the kidneys. This comprehensive, multi-pronged approach means GLP-1 RAs are not just treating diabetes; they are actively safeguarding kidney function at a fundamental level.

Navigating GLP-1 Therapy with Existing Kidney Conditions

For individuals already managing chronic kidney disease (CKD), the emergence of GLP-1 receptor agonists (GLP-1 RAs) presents a complex but often promising new dimension in treatment strategies. While initially approved for type 2 diabetes and weight management, a growing body of evidence, solidified by major cardiovascular and renal outcome trials, highlights their potential benefits for kidney health, making the discussion around GLP-1 kidney disease increasingly relevant.

The established benefits of GLP-1 RAs extend beyond glycemic control. These medications have demonstrated significant cardiovascular protective effects, which are particularly crucial given the strong link between heart and kidney disease. More specifically for the kidneys, clinical trials have shown that GLP-1 RAs can:

  • Reduce Albuminuria: A key indicator of kidney damage, albuminuria (excess protein in urine) has been consistently shown to decrease with GLP-1 RA therapy in many patients.
  • Slow eGFR Decline: While not a cure, these therapies have been observed to slow the rate of decline in estimated glomerular filtration rate (eGFR), preserving kidney function over time for some individuals.
  • Influence Blood Pressure and Inflammation: Beyond direct renal effects, GLP-1 RAs can contribute to better blood pressure control and reduce systemic inflammation, both of which are beneficial for overall kidney health.

However, integrating GLP-1 therapy into the management plan for someone with existing kidney conditions requires careful consideration and an individualized approach. It's not a one-size-fits-all solution:

  • Individualized Assessment is Key: The suitability of GLP-1 RAs depends on the specific stage of CKD, co-existing medical conditions, and other medications being taken. What works for one person may not be appropriate for another.
  • Dosage Adjustments: For individuals with more advanced stages of CKD, dosage adjustments of certain GLP-1 RAs may be necessary to ensure safety and efficacy. Your healthcare provider will determine the appropriate regimen.
  • Monitoring for Side Effects: Common gastrointestinal side effects like nausea, vomiting, and diarrhea can sometimes lead to dehydration. In individuals with compromised kidney function, dehydration can be particularly risky, potentially exacerbating kidney stress. Close monitoring and management of these side effects are crucial.
  • Holistic Management: GLP-1 RAs are part of a broader strategy. They work best when combined with other pillars of CKD management, including blood pressure control, dietary modifications, and other renoprotective medications.

Monitoring Kidney Function While on GLP-1 Medications

As GLP-1 receptor agonists continue to demonstrate significant benefits for individuals with type 2 diabetes, obesity, and cardiovascular disease, their role in managing or mitigating the progression of GLP-1 kidney disease has become increasingly recognized. Even with these positive outcomes, diligent monitoring of kidney function remains a cornerstone of safe and effective treatment. Regular assessments empower healthcare providers to ensure the medication is working optimally, identify any potential issues early, and make necessary adjustments to your care plan.

Essential Kidney Function Tests

Your healthcare team will typically focus on several crucial markers to track your kidney health:

  • Estimated Glomerular Filtration Rate (eGFR): This blood test measures how well your kidneys filter waste. A stable or improving eGFR is a positive sign. Your eGFR is a primary factor in determining the appropriate dosage of many GLP-1 medications, especially in individuals with moderate to severe kidney impairment.
  • Urine Albumin-to-Creatinine Ratio (UACR): This urine test checks for albumin, a protein, in your urine. Elevated albumin levels can be an early sign of kidney damage. Monitoring UACR helps assess albuminuria, a key indicator in GLP-1 kidney disease management.
  • Blood Pressure: High blood pressure is a major risk factor for kidney disease. Regular monitoring ensures it remains within a healthy range, protecting your kidneys. Many GLP-1s can also contribute to beneficial blood pressure reduction.
  • Electrolytes: Changes in electrolytes (e.g., sodium, potassium) can sometimes occur, particularly if dehydration is present or in individuals with advanced kidney disease.

Why Regular Monitoring is Crucial

Consistent assessment serves several vital purposes:

  • Personalized Dosage Adjustment: GLP-1 medications are often dosed based on kidney function. If your kidney function changes, your doctor may need to adjust your medication dose to ensure efficacy and minimize potential side effects.
  • Early Detection of Complications: Monitoring helps detect rare instances of acute kidney injury (often related to dehydration from gastrointestinal side effects) or other unforeseen changes promptly.
  • Tracking Disease Progression: For those already living with kidney disease, regular tests provide valuable data on whether the condition is stable, improving, or progressing, allowing for timely interventions.

Holistic Kidney Care: Lifestyle & GLP-1s for Long-Term Health

GLP-1 receptor agonists have emerged as a significant advancement in managing conditions that often impact kidney health, such as type 2 diabetes and obesity. However, it's crucial to understand that these medications are most effective when integrated into a broader, holistic strategy for long-term kidney well-being. Focusing solely on medication without addressing foundational lifestyle factors would be missing a vital piece of the puzzle.

The Foundation: Lifestyle Interventions

While GLP-1s offer remarkable benefits, the bedrock of kidney health remains consistent: diligent lifestyle management. This includes a nutrient-rich diet, regular physical activity, maintaining healthy blood pressure, and optimal blood sugar control.

  • Dietary Choices: Prioritize a plant-forward eating pattern, lower in sodium, processed foods, and unhealthy fats. Hydration is key, but always discuss fluid intake with your doctor, especially if you have existing kidney concerns.
  • Regular Movement: Aim for consistent physical activity, tailored to your abilities. Exercise helps manage weight, blood pressure, and blood sugar, all critical for kidney protection.
  • Blood Pressure Management: High blood pressure is a leading cause of kidney damage. Regular monitoring and adherence to prescribed treatments, alongside lifestyle adjustments, are essential.
  • Blood Sugar Control: For those with diabetes, maintaining stable blood glucose levels is paramount to preventing or slowing the progression of diabetic kidney disease.

Integrating GLP-1s into Your Plan

This is where the power of GLP-1s truly shines in a holistic context. For individuals where appropriate, these medications can significantly enhance the protective effects on the kidneys. Studies continue to highlight how GLP-1 receptor agonists can reduce the risk of adverse kidney outcomes, making them a valuable tool in the comprehensive management of **GLP-1 kidney disease** prevention and progression. They work synergistically with lifestyle changes, helping to achieve better blood sugar control, promote weight loss, and potentially offer direct renoprotective effects, thus supporting the kidneys' long-term function.
